Section two: Object
two.1) Scope of the procurement
two.1.1) Title
NU/1707 - The Provision of International Market Research and Business Development - USA
Reference number
NU/1707
two.1.2) Main CPV code
- 75100000 - Administration services
two.1.3) Type of contract
Services
two.1.4) Short description
The University wishes to enhance capacity to engage with students interested in studying in the UK and to build the profile and the brand of the University across the US and to broaden the range of its activities in the USA, including the development of academic partnerships with high quality HEIs, development of relations with government, NGO and corporate organisations, exchange and placement of students and staff for studies, work, and other forms of experiential learning.
two.1.5) Estimated total value
Value excluding VAT: £1,100,000
two.1.6) Information about lots
This contract is divided into lots: No

six.4.3) Review procedure
Precise information on deadline(s) for review procedures
The University will incorporate a standstill period at the point information on the award of the contract is communicated to tenderers. That notification will provide full information on the award decision. The standstill period, which will be for a minimum of 10 calendar days, provides time for unsuccessful tenderers to challenge the award decision before the contract is entered into.
The Public Contracts Regulations 2015 (SI 2015 No 102) provide for aggrieved parties who have been harmed or are at risk of harm by a breach of the rules to take action in the High Court (England, Wales and Northern Ireland) within 30 days of knowledge or constructive knowledge of breach.
